Back inside the fourteenth century mechanical clocks appeared. A bell sounded just about every hour. These clocks did not have hands or faces. The speed of the clocks movement was driven by weights and springs. One of the most important event in clock creating took place within the early nineteenth century. It was the introduction of mass production and interchangeable parts. Just before this time clocks were only out there to the wealthy. The cuckoo clock is usually pendulum driven and strikes the hours using small bellows and pipes that imitate the call of the prevalent cuckoo additionally to striking a wire gong. This mechanism was produced given that the eighteenth century and has remained just about with out variation until the present. Within the nineteen fifties electrical currents ran via quartz crystals which caused vibrations to operate the movements. This type of movement is employed in several of our wall clocks today.

The very first version of the well-known clock as we know it right now was produced around 1738 by Franz Anton Ketterer, from the village of Sch?nwald near Triberg. It's thought that he was inspired by both the cry of a rooster along with other clocks decorated with scenes of farm life, but found the sound of the cuckoo bird easier to generate than the rooster's crow. Germany already had a lengthy history of fine clock-making just before the Cuckoo Clock came on the scene. Artisans had been making ornate clocks entirely by hand, including all of the gears and moving parts inside and also the casing and decorations. The first Cuckoo Clock and those following inside the early years of production were also made entirely by hand. Later, the use of metal parts along with the incorporation of the pendulum provided additional accurate timekeeping. A pendulum clock has a weight at the end that, as soon as swinging, swings back and forth at the same rate all the time and moves the gears continuously. Little weights hanging from under the clock, often in the shape of pinecones on a Cuckoo Clock, are pulled on a standard basis to continue the pendulum's swing and keep accurate time. The mechanism that makes the clock go "coo-coo" is still utilised nowadays: bellows that push air through smaller pipes, similar to how a pipe organ works. Clocks could be produced inside the winter, and inside the spring, clock salesmen (Uhrschleppers) would take them all over Europe. In 1712, Friedrich Dilger went to France to study clock creating, and brought back to Germany a wealth of new ideas. Soon immediately after, clocks became pretty elaborate, and had been generally decorated with moving figures such as roosters crowing and men and women dancing. At the end of the eighteenth century and up to the middle of the nineteenth century Cuckoo Clocks basically consisted of a a flat wooden face with the workings of the clock attached behind the face. On leading of the face of the clock was place a semi circular piece of wood which was adorned with gorgeous designs and which housed the cuckoo bird. Throughout the cold winter nights the clock makers would work creating their attractive extremely decorated clocks. Within the Spring the clocks were then sold by door to door by clock peddlers who carried the Cuckoo Clocks by means of a rack which was carried on their backs. Whole families would function in their cottages generating the Cuckoo Clocks and each and every family member had the expertise of generating specific pieces of the clock which was then assembled by yet a further family members member. Styles of Cuckoo Clocks: There are lots of styles of Cuckoo Clocks, the most familiar being the Swiss Chalet Style which evolved about the end of the nineteenth century. The most simple type of Cuckoo Clock is the One Day Cuckoo Clock which needs to be wound one time each and every day. Next there's the Eight Day Cuckoo Clock which wants to be wound only 1 time per week. Every of these clocks has a musical version together with the addition of a Swiss music box. Animated figures now are added such as a man sawing wood, men drinking beer and even a water wheel turning. Themes of the Cuckoo Clock consist of deer heads, dead and live animals, leaves and birds. Later versions now incorporate a Quartz Cuckoo Clock which does not must be wound and which has the recorded sound of an actual Cuckoo. The production center of the Cuckoo Clock is still the Black Forest of Germany, and the Cuckoo Clock is still a preferred of the tourist visiting there. May well stories including such as those for young children have been written about Cuckoo Clocks and like the Cuckoo Clocks themselves they remain popular to this day.
